Understanding the Risk
Many sites face challenges when Request.Path values are improperly handled. A common issue is the receipt of unsafe path values from untrusted clients, which can lead to security breaches such as cross-site scripting (XSS) or directory traversal attacks. Tools and frameworks are evolving to better detect and manage these threats.

FAQs: Navigating Web Security
What is a Request.Path?
This represents the URI of the page that is relative to the site root. Handling Request.Path values securely is crucial to prevent unauthorized access.
Why is it important to monitor these paths?
Unmanaged or malicious path values can result in unauthorized data access or file manipulation, making it essential to monitor and control incoming web requests.
